The Grammy-winning singer is talking out about alleged harassment that has been plaguing his household, which comes as he and his spouse, Margaret Zhang, put together to welcome their second little one together.
Miguel opened up about the assaults in a prolonged assertion posted to Instagram, in which he describes what he says has been a troublesome yr for his family members. According to the artist, his household has confronted racism, harassment, stalking, and privateness invasions.
“There is a difference between public commentary and abuse,” he started. “Over the past year, my family and the people i love have been subjected to racism, harassment, stalking, invasions of privacy, and false allegations.”
The singer continued: “Recent racist and anti-Asian attacks directed at my partner – including comments and DMs, as well as abusive comments about my child – crossed a line that should require no explanation. People can have opinions about me. about the music. about the work. I accept the realities that come with doing anything in public.”
“But racism, threats, harassment, stalking, invasions of privacy, and targeting of children are abuse. not opinion,” Miguel asserted. “It doesn’t become acceptable because someone dresses it up as criticism, fandom, speculation, or ‘concern.’ Responsibility also lies with organizations and individuals that knowingly amplify or enable racism, harassment, or false allegations for attention and engagement.”
The singer wrapped up his assertion by writing, “If you participate in this behavior, you are not supporting me. you are not part of this community. Where legal and ethical lines have been crossed, action has been and will continue to be taken. To everyone who has treated my family with kindness, dignity, and respect: we see you. we deeply appreciate you.”
